A fire early Saturday severely damaged a Victorian house that had been converted into three apartments on 3rd Street near U Street.
The Sacramento Fire Department, assisted by the West Sacramento Fire Department, responded to two alarms at 6 a.m., according to Sacramento department spokesman Chris Harvey. He said the blaze was quelled in 30 minutes by 40 firefighters, but the house is uninhabitable.
There were no injuries, Harvey said. Six occupants were evacuated and a dog was rescued by firefighters. The cause of the fire remains under investigation.
Sacramento Red Cross workers are helping place the building’s displaced residents in temporary housing, Harvey said.
